Architectural and Engineering Managers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Architectural and Engineering Managers occupation accounted for over 197 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 5.4%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$163,310, and the median wage was $159,920.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 163.8%.

Registered Nurses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Registered Nurses occupation accounted for over 3.1 million j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 0.8%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$89,010, and the median wage was $81,220.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 43.8%.
Chief Executives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Chief Executives occupation accounted for over 199 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ting a decrease of 0.6%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$246,440, and the median wage was $189,520.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 298.1%.
Computer Systems Analysts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Computer Systems Analysts occupation accounted for over 505 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 0%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$107,530, and the median wage was $102,240.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 73.7%.
Personal Financial Advisors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Personal Financial Advisors occupation accounted for over 283 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 7.6%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$137,740, and the median wage was $95,390.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 122.5%.
Pharmacists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Pharmacists occupation accounted for over 325 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 4.1%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$129,410, and the median wage was $132,750.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 109.1%.
Project Management Specialists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Project Management Specialists occupation accounted for over 844 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 13.5%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$101,610, and the median wage was $95,370.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 64.2%.
Management Analysts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Management Analysts occupation accounted for over 809 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 5.3%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$104,660, and the median wage was $95,290.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 69.1%.
Marketing Managers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Marketing Managers occupation accounted for over 329 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 17.9%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$158,280, and the median wage was $140,040.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 155.7%.
Medical and Health Services Managers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Medical and Health Services Managers occupation accounted for over 477 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 9.2%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$127,980, and the median wage was $104,830.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 106.8%.
Sales Managers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Sales Managers occupation accounted for over 536 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 18.2%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$150,530, and the median wage was $130,600.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 143.2%.
Computer and Information Systems Managers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Computer and Information Systems Managers occupation accounted for over 533 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 9.9%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$173,670, and the median wage was $164,070.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 180.6%.
Lawyers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Lawyers occupation accounted for over 707 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 3.8%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$163,770, and the median wage was $135,740.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 164.6%.
General and Operations Managers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the General and Operations Managers occupation accounted for over 3.4 million j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 13.1%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$122,860, and the median wage was $98,100.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 98.5%.
Financial Managers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Financial Managers occupation accounted for over 741 thousand j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 8.8%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$166,050, and the median wage was $139,790.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 168.3%.
Software Developers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Software Developers occupation accounted for over 1.5 million jobs in the United States, reflecting an increase of 12.5%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$132,930, and the median wage was $127,260. Compared to the national average for all occupations, the wages for this occupation were higher by 114.7%.
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ing and Hunting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ing and Hunting industry employed over 423 thousand people in the United States, reflecting an increase of 2%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$40,220, and the median wage was $34,020. Compared to the national average, the wages in this industry group were lower by 35%.
Mining, Quarrying, and Oil and Gas Extraction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Mining, Quarrying, and Oil and Gas Extraction industry employed over 527 thousand people in the United States, reflecting an increase of 7.3%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$73,090, and the median wage was $59,270. Compared to the national average, the wages in this industry group were higher by 18.1%.
Utilities Employment and Wages in 2022
In 2022, the Utilities industry employed over 543 thousand people in the United States, reflecting an increase of 0.6% from 2021. The annual mean wage in 2022 was $93,650, and the median wage was $91,990. Compared to the national average, the wages in this industry group were higher by 51.3%.
